我使用一个旧程序(Rich Copy)将文件从一个驱动器复制到另一个驱动器。文件和目录结构都已创建,但由于某些文件名和目录名较长,某些文件未复制。目标驱动器已处于实时生产状态,因此我不想重新运行复制命令。
我将所有未复制的文件导出到 excel 列表中。对于每一行,我想从源驱动器 (S: 驱动器) 复制到本地 (D:\share)
源文件列表示例:
S:\directory_abc\department2\file1.txt
S:\directory_abc\department3\version 2\file2.txt
我希望文件放入以下文件夹(Rich Copy 已经创建的文件夹):
D:\共享\目录_abc\部门2\文件1.txt
D:\share\directory_abc\department3\version 2\file2.txt
我该如何使用 PowerShell 来执行此操作?谢谢。